Deekline & Wizard released "Ill Street Blues" in 2004 on Botchit & Scarper, the UK label known for breakbeat and nu-skool releases. The title track pairs breakbeat rhythms with UK garage textures, and the record includes two remixes from MJ Cole -- the garage and 2-step producer behind Sincere -- offering both a full remix and a dub version across the B-side.

Expert, honest grading

Used records and CDs are graded when we catalogue them for sale and again before they are sent out. So they should reach you in the condition you expect.

Every used record and CD pro-cleaned

We clean our used vinyl records using a VPI vacuum cleaner. More expensive records are also cleaned ultrasonically. CDs are cleaned gently by hand.

Re-sleeving

We place each used record in a brand new paper or anti-static audiophile inner sleeve. We then place the record and sleeve (separately) into a brand new outer sleeve. Ready to be enjoyed!
